The “Ryzenfall” of AMD

Security research firm CTS has disclosed four critical flaws in AMD’s latest CPU models based on the ZEN architecture: Ryzen and EPYC. Ironically enough the Secure Processor located on the main CPU is the source of the vulnerability. While the firm’s motivation is under some scrutiny due to poor reporting practices, the vulnerabilities appear to be real enough with some terrifying implications. Usually, a compromised machine can be cleaned of the infection and defended again with the appropriate patches or software upgrades. Not anymore. Three of the flaws, dubbed Ryzenfall, Fallout, and Masterkey, allow an attacker to plant malware in a “secure enclave” thereby skipping all detection and other security controls such as Microsoft’s Credential Guard, Virtualization based Security, and AMD’s own firmware Trusted Platform Module (fTPM), or they can just brick your motherboard. 23 NYCRR 500 – The deadline has passed, but there’s still time.

The New York Department of Financial Services announced a new cybersecurity regulation (23 NYCRR 500), on March 1st, 2017, due to the increase of consistency and sophistication of cyber attacks over recent years. In fairness, much of the requirements are “standard issue” in most compliance frameworks, lack of adherence to applicable New York businesses will result in fines.  Even with continual extensions, the deadline for compliance was set as February 15, 2018. Like other initiatives, such as DFARS and PTC, we are seeing entities struggle to meet the requirements. As an IT Professional or business in the financial industry, a whole new level of responsibility has been forced onto your shoulders, whether based in New York or in a company that operates within the State. AutoSploit and Collateral Damage

  Last week, a toolkit was released, that based solely on results from Shodan, would automatically engage vulnerable devices around the world with exploit code.  A short time ago, right after the release of MIRAI, a fellow team member had developed some code that would scour the Internet, find devices using default credentials and automatically reset them.  We had a long discussion about the legality of using such code. His modification of the MIRAI botnet would scan the Internet for devices using default credentials and reset those credentials or shut down the device, all together. Essentially, it's the loose interpretation of walking around a neighborhood, breaking into homes, for the sole purpose of locking the windows. In that context, it's absolutely illegal.
